What is a Robotic Kidney Transplant?

A Robotic Kidney Transplant is an advanced surgical procedure where a healthy kidney from a living or deceased donor is placed into a recipient with end-stage renal disease, utilizing robotic assistance. The robotic system allows surgeons to perform the transplant through smaller incisions, offering enhanced precision, magnified 3D visualization, and greater dexterity compared to traditional open surgery. This minimally invasive approach aims to reduce blood loss, minimize pain, shorten hospital stays, and accelerate recovery for the patient. The new kidney takes over the function of filtering waste products from the blood, essential for life.

Types of Kidney Transplant Procedures

While Robotic Kidney Transplant is a specific approach, kidney transplantation can broadly be categorized by the surgical method and donor type:

  • Robotic-Assisted Transplant: Performed with the aid of a surgical robot, allowing for minimally invasive insertion of the donor kidney through small incisions. This is the focus of care discussed here.
  • Laparoscopic-Assisted Transplant: Involves keyhole surgery, but typically without the enhanced dexterity and 3D visualization offered by a robotic system. It is also a minimally invasive option.
  • Open Kidney Transplant: The traditional method involving a larger incision to implant the donor kidney. This remains a viable option, particularly in complex cases or specific patient anatomies.
  • Living Donor Transplant: A kidney is donated by a living person, often a family member or close friend, or an altruistic donor. These transplants generally have higher success rates and shorter waiting times.
  • Deceased Donor Transplant: A kidney is obtained from a deceased individual whose family has consented to organ donation.

When is Robotic Kidney Transplant Required?

  • End-stage renal disease (ESRD) caused by conditions such as chronic glomerulonephritis
  • Long-standing uncontrolled diabetes leading to kidney damage (diabetic nephropathy)
  • Uncontrolled high blood pressure causing kidney failure (hypertensive nephrosclerosis)
  • Polycystic kidney disease, a genetic disorder causing fluid-filled cysts in the kidneys
  • Systemic lupus erythematosus or other autoimmune diseases affecting kidney function
  • Severe kidney damage from recurrent urinary tract infections or congenital defects
  • Failure of previous kidney transplants or other kidney-related complications

Pre-Treatment Evaluation for Kidney Transplant

  • Comprehensive medical history review and physical examination for both donor and recipient
  • Detailed blood tests including blood type, tissue typing (HLA matching), cross-matching, and infection screening (HIV, Hepatitis B, C)
  • Urinalysis to assess kidney function and detect any urinary tract infections
  • Advanced imaging studies such as CT scans, MRIs, and ultrasounds of the kidneys and surrounding structures
  • Cardiac evaluation including ECG, echocardiogram, and sometimes a stress test to assess heart health
  • Pulmonary function tests to evaluate lung capacity and health
  • Psychological evaluation to ensure mental preparedness for the transplant journey and adherence to post-transplant care
  • Cancer screenings appropriate for age and risk factors

How Robotic Kidney Transplant is Performed

The exact procedure for a Robotic Kidney Transplant depends on the patient's specific condition and the surgeon's plan. Generally, it involves several precise steps facilitated by robotic technology.

Preparation and Anesthesia: The recipient is prepared for surgery and administered general anesthesia. The surgical team sterilizes the abdominal area.

Robot Docking and Incisions: Small incisions are made in the lower abdomen. Robotic ports are inserted, and the surgical robot is docked, allowing the surgeon to control its instruments remotely from a console.

Kidney Placement: The donor kidney, typically prepared beforehand, is carefully guided through a slightly larger incision (often referred to as a "Pfannenstiel incision" or bikini cut) in the lower abdomen.

Vascular Anastomosis: Using the robotic instruments, the surgeon meticulously connects the renal artery and vein of the new kidney to the recipient's iliac artery and vein. This critical step ensures proper blood flow to the transplanted organ.

Ureteric Anastomosis: The ureter (the tube that carries urine from the kidney) of the new kidney is then connected to the recipient's bladder. A stent may be placed temporarily to ensure proper drainage.

Closure: Once the connections are secure and blood flow is confirmed, the robotic instruments are removed, and the incisions are carefully closed.

Recovery Process After Robotic Kidney Transplant

The recovery period after a Robotic Kidney Transplant typically involves a hospital stay of about 5-7 days. Patients are closely monitored for signs of rejection, infection, and proper kidney function. Pain management is crucial, and early mobilization is encouraged. Post-discharge, patients must adhere to a strict medication regimen, primarily immunosuppressants, to prevent rejection of the new kidney. Regular follow-up appointments, including blood tests and check-ups, are vital. A gradual return to normal activities is expected, with full recovery taking several weeks to months, often involving dietary modifications and avoiding strenuous activities during the initial phase.

Risks and Success Rates

  • Infection, a common concern due to immunosuppressive medications
  • Bleeding during or after the surgical procedure
  • Rejection of the transplanted kidney by the recipient's immune system
  • Blood clots forming in the vessels connected to the new kidney
  • Urinary complications, such as leakage or blockages in the ureter
  • Side effects from immunosuppressant drugs, including high blood pressure, diabetes, and increased risk of cancer
  • Delayed graft function, where the new kidney takes time to start working effectively
  • Failure of the transplanted kidney, necessitating further treatment or another transplant

The success rates for kidney transplantation are generally high, particularly with living donors and advanced robotic techniques. One-year graft survival rates often exceed 90-95%, and five-year survival rates can range from 75-85%, depending on various factors such as donor type, recipient's overall health, and adherence to post-transplant care. Long-term outcomes vary for each individual, influenced by ongoing health management, medication compliance, and lifestyle choices.

Cost of Robotic Kidney Transplant in New Delhi

The cost of a Robotic Kidney Transplant in New Delhi is influenced by several factors. These include the hospital's infrastructure and reputation, the experience of the surgical team and transplant specialists, the specific robotic technology used, the duration of the hospital stay, and any additional pre- or post-operative complications or treatments required.

A Robotic Kidney Transplant in New Delhi typically ranges from INR 1,500,000 to INR 2,800,000.

New Delhi vs. Global Robotic Kidney Transplant Costs

New Delhi offers a highly competitive cost advantage for Robotic Kidney Transplants while maintaining international standards of care and technology. Below is a comparison of average costs:

Location Average Cost (USD)
New Delhi $18,000 - $34,000
United States $120,000 - $180,000
United Kingdom $90,000 - $140,000
Singapore $70,000 - $110,000
Thailand $45,000 - $70,000

Guidance for Aftercare and Recovery

  • Adhere strictly to the prescribed immunosuppressant medication schedule
  • Maintain regular contact with your transplant coordinator for follow-up advice
  • Attend all scheduled post-operative appointments and blood tests
  • Follow dietary restrictions and lifestyle recommendations provided by your medical team
  • Avoid strenuous activities and heavy lifting for several weeks as advised
  • Monitor for any signs of infection, fever, or changes in urine output and report immediately
  • Ensure a clean and hygienic environment to minimize infection risk
